Carrier Recalls Packaged Terminal Air Conditioners and Heat Pumps Due to Fire Hazard
Carrier is recalling about 185,000 packaged terminal air conditioners and heat pumps because an electric heater can break and cause a fire.

Plain-English summary
Carrier Corp. is recalling about 185,000 packaged terminal air conditioners (PTAC) and packaged terminal heat pumps (PTHP) manufactured between 2002 and 2005. The recall involves model numbers 52C, 52P, and unbranded model 84 units sold through the Bryant and FAST channels. These units were sold with 208/230 and 265 volts and have capacities of 7,000, 9,000, 12,000, and 15,000 BTUs.
The recall is due to a fire hazard caused by an electric heater in the unit that can break. Carrier has received five reports of electric heater failures resulting in fires contained to the unit. No injuries have been reported.
The units were sold through HVAC dealers and factory-direct sales from January 2002 through December 2006 for between $425 and $675. Consumers should stop using the heating mode of the recalled units until they are inspected in accordance with Carrier's inspection instructions. Consumers should contact Carrier to receive a free repair.
